Installing Memory

Caution

Static electricity can damage dual
in-line memory modules (DIMMs).
When handling DIMMs, either wear an
antistatic wrist strap or frequently touch
the surface of the DIMM’s antistatic
package, then touch bare metal on the
printer.

If you have not already done so, print a
configuration page to find out how
much memory is installed in the printer
before adding more memory
(page 134).

1 Turn the printer off. Rotate the printer

for access to its right side. Unplug the
power cord and disconnect any
cables.

2 Grasp the cover (as illustrated) and

pull it firmly toward the rear of the
printer until it stops.

3 Remove the cover from the printer.

4 Loosen the captive screw holding the

DIMM access door with a Phillips #2
screwdriver. Open the door.
